Product Selection
If you're considering buying a scooter, it is crucial to be patient and think about all the options available. You must consider the comfort, ease of control and driving and safety features. Also, you should consider the terrain on which you will use it, since this will impact how well it performs.
You'll need to pick between three and four wheel scooters, based on your requirements. Three wheel scooters are lighter in weight and new mobility scooters for sale are generally designed for indoor usage, while four wheel scooters are much sturdier and can be used outdoors.
You will also want to examine the maximum weight capacity of the unit as this can affect its durability and the distance it will travel on a battery charge. Also, consider the turning radius as it can affect how easy you will be to maneuver the unit. It is also important to consider the accessories included with the unit. For instance the use of a vehicle lift or ramp could make it easier for you to transport and store your scooter.

Advantages
A scooter is an ideal solution for people who have trouble to get around on their own. However, it comes with some disadvantages. Scooters are not small and may make it difficult to get around in a car unless they have a vehicle lift. They're not as transportable as other mobility devices such as walkers or rollators, which can be easily fitted into trunks or on public transport vehicles.
Scooters require regular maintenance, which includes replacement of tires, battery replacement and alignment of the steering or suspension. The costs for these can be high.
Another drawback is that older people tend to become dependent on their scooters to the point they do not get enough exercise, which could lead to weight gain. This can be counteracted by a balanced mix of walking and scootering as suggested by an occupational therapist.
